Our imaging reports are reviewed by Specialist Vascular Surgeon Dr Rick Bond, Associate Professor at the University of Western Australia, State Director of Vascular Surgery for Western Australia, and Head of Vascular Surgery at Fiona Stanley and Fremantle Hospitals. Dr Bond also serves as an examiner for the Royal Australian College of Surgeons (RACS).

For medically urgent findings, the referring clinician will be contacted immediately, and a preliminary report will be provided prior to patient discharge. If the referring doctor is unavailable, the patient will be advised to attend the nearest emergency department, accompanied by a copy of the report.

Our Vascular Sonographer

Amanda Stent is an Accredited Medical Vascular Sonographer, having earned her Diploma of Medical Ultrasound in Vascular Sonography with the Australasian Society for Ultrasound in Medicine. She received specialised training at a Perth cardiovascular clinic and has been mentored by multiple Vascular Surgeons across both metropolitan and regional Western Australia. Her ultrasound examinations are characterised by meticulous attention to detail and the inclusion of dedicated surgical information, ensuring surgeons receive critical data to support optimal patient care.

Amanda’s 15 years of clinical experience extends to intraoperative ultrasound for varicose vein procedures, including Endovenous Laser Therapy (EVLT), Radiofrequency Ablation (RFA), Glue (Venaseal), and sclerotherapy.

She has also gained international experience within the UK NHS, collaborating in multidisciplinary teams at University Lewisham Hospital and Greenwich Hospital.

Amanda has contributed to research studies focusing on arteriovenous fistulas, aspiration catheters, and intravascular lithotripsy in partnership with Vascore, Corelab Black Forest, and the Yale Cardiovascular Research Group.

Specialist Consulting Lists

We offer specialised ultrasound services to Vascular Surgeons across the Perth region, delivered by an experienced Vascular Sonographer equipped with the latest portable ultrasound technology. This enables efficient, high-quality imaging to be performed during patient consultations, enhancing collaboration between Specialist and patient.

Our Sonographer’s strong time management skills and clinical expertise ensure seamless integration into your practice workflow. All scans are bulk billed for Medicare-eligible patients, with the option to complete multiple studies on the same day.

Following each scan, a preliminary worksheet will be reviewed with you in person, including the opportunity to discuss real-time images prior to patient consultation. Comprehensive final reports are completed at the conclusion of the session and sent for your signature. Once signed, reports are forwarded directly to your clinic administration.

The Importance of Choosing a Vascular Sonographer

Sonographer training varies widely, and the accuracy of vascular imaging and diagnostic outcomes depends significantly on the expertise of the operator. Vascular Sonographers undergo specialised training exclusively focused on vascular ultrasound, culminating in the attainment of a Diploma in Vascular Medical Ultrasound.

Through extensive experience in dedicated vascular environments, these sonographers develop advanced clinical knowledge, critical thinking, and analytical skills, alongside highly refined technical proficiency. Their deep understanding of vascular anatomy and pathology enables them to navigate the complexities of imaging the circulatory system, often located in challenging anatomical regions and complicated by patient-specific factors.

This rigorous training and practical experience empower Vascular Sonographers to apply theoretical principles and clinical reasoning effectively, providing provisional and differential diagnoses critical for patient management.

At CoreWave Vascular, all scans are conducted exclusively by sonographers who hold this specialised Vascular Diploma. We do not employ sonographers with a General Diploma in Medical Ultrasound and supplementary 'vascular training,' as this does not equate to the comprehensive education required for vascular imaging excellence.
